Thin Lizzy: The Boys Are Back in Town

Experience the power of Thin Lizzy live! In October of 1978, more than 26,000 screaming fans packed the grounds of the Sydney Opera House in Australia for an unforgettable concert by this monster rock 'n roll band. With Guitar Greats, Scotty Gorhan and Gary Moore; front man Phil Lynott blasting the bass line and singing his heart out, it's no wonder there was standing room only. The 70's were a time when four-piece power bands ruled rock music, and Thin Lizzy was one of the best! 2022 re-release features additional footage, remixed audio, cleaned up picture, and truly captures Thin Lizzy at the top of their game.

X-Ray Spex: Live at the Roundhouse London

After a 13 year hiatus, X-Ray Spex reunited for a single show at the Roundhouse, London on Sept. 6, 2008. Unlike some of the "we're only in it for the money" reunions, X-Ray Spex are in great form. The twenty-track set includes almost the entirety of Germ Free Adolescents ("Plastic Bag" is the only track not played) and Poly Styrene's voice has held up exceptionally well given that Germ Free Adolescents was released thirty years ago. Other songs include three tracks from X-Ray Spex's 2005 reunion Conscious Consumer along with one new and previously unreleased track "Bloody War".

Mike Portnoy - Liquid Drum Theater

This 2-disc DVD set features Mike Portnoy of Dream Theater. Volume One features music of Dream Theater and Liquid Tension Experiment, with Mike performing eight songs & segments, breaking down parts of each. Featured throughout is exclusive footage of the making of the first LTE album, as well as rare live footage of the band. Volume Two focuses on the muic of Dream Theater. Mike performs eleven songs/segments from "Falling Into Infinity" and "Scenes From a Memory;" there is also exclusive live footage of Dream Theater's 1998 World Tour.

Elton 60: Live At Madison Square Garden

Elton John performs some of his biggest hits and several fan favourites in Elton 60: Live at Madison Square Garden. The release features appearances onstage by comedians Robin Williams and Whoopi Goldberg, as well as special remarks to the audience by lyricist Bernie Taupin. The concert was recorded on Elton's 60th birthday, 25 March 2007, and coincides with his world record-setting 60th concert at Madison Square Garden in New York City. In addition to his regular band, a choir also performs on several songs.

Cesar Camargo Mariano e Pedro Mariano - Piano & Voz

With a career that has passed the 40-year mark, Cesar Camargo Mariano continues to stay on top of his game. His arranging skills are unique and are permanently set in Brazilian music through singers such as Elis Regina, Simone and just about the best in Brazil and around the world. On the other side of this duo, we find Pedro Mariano, son of Cesar Camargo Mariano and the late Elis Regina. Though father and son had previously collaborated in Pedro’s three solo albums, with Piano & Voz they formalize that artistic synergy with a memorable recording (also available on DVD). Piano & Voz had a limited release of 10,000 units, but in case you are not able to get a hold of the album, there is also DVD release of the same project. Balkan Rock Legends

"Balkan Rock Legends", a group based in Amsterdam, has been around for 4 years. They play rock'n'roll from a country that no longer exist. The band's repertoire includes songs from over 50 groups and artists who marked YU-rock. They don't play it "in their own way", but as close as possible to the original at concerts that last at least 3 hours. Their status as a "cover band" is very relative, considering that many members and guests perform their own original songs.

Faxed Head: From Coalinga to Osaka (Live in Japan 1995)

Beautifully shot on three cameras during Faxed Head's improbable 1995 tour of Japan, From Coalinga To Osaka documents the pride of Coalinga, CA in all their self-handicapped, brain-damaged glory. Live footage of the self-proclaimed “desk metal” quartet is interspersed with baffling but authentic footage of a Japanese junior high school class in which the students are being instructed on the subject of... Faxed Head! In addition to the electronics- and mayhem-heavy 1995 Osaka set, the DVD includes bonus live footage of a reconstituted (and much more metal-sounding) Faxed Head on tour in Canada in 2001. And, for the true fan, a 45-minute long hidden "Easter egg" showcases an entire concert by Faxed Head's long-time nemesis, pitiful Coalinga-area boogie-blues idiots The Bon Larvis Band.
